Arunachal: Digital Financial Literacy and Awareness Camp

farmers and villagers took part in a digital financial literacy and awareness programme organised at  Changlang district of Arunachal Pradesh.

As many as 30 people including farmers and SHG members attended a digital financial literacy and awareness programme organised by the Changlang branch of the Arunachal Pradesh State Co-operative Apex Bank Ltd. (APSCAB Ltd.) at Longlung village in Changlang district on Tuesday.

The camp was supported by NABARD Arunachal Pradesh Regional Office, Itanagar.

APSCAB Ltd. Branch Manager Jayanta Dutta explained the different types of accounts that can be maintained in a bank.

He also informed the gathering about the schemes that bank account holders can avail of, and highlighted social security schemes such as PMJDY, PMSBY, PMJJBY, and APY.

NABARD District Development Manager Kamal Roy informed about financial inclusion and financial planning.

He also briefed the participants on the flagship schemes of both the state and the central governments viz CMKRY, DDUBY, DDUSY, DEDS, NLM, KCC etc., and explained the procedure for availing benefits under the schemes.
